Dunai - Multai, Betul
Dunai is a village situated in the Multai tehsil of Betul district, Madhya Pradesh. It is located approximately 31 km from the tehsil headquarters in Multai and around 83 km from the district headquarters in Betul. Dunava serves as the Gram Panchayat for Dunai village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Dunai is 486315. The village covers a total geographical area of 327 hectares and falls under the 460663 pincode. Multai is the nearest town, located about 31 km away.
Dunai village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Multai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Betul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Dunai
As per Census 2011, Dunai village has a total population of 736 people, consisting of 362 males and 374 females. The village has 149 households and a sex ratio of 1,033 females per 1,000 males. There are 81 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 490 literate and 246 illiterate residents. Additionally, 30 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 65 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Dunai
Dunai is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ared van services. The nearest railway station is Hatna Pur, while the nearest airport is Dr. Babasaheb Ambedkar International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 83.4 km.
